From Webster's Revised Unabridged Dictionary (1913) [web1913]: | |
Palpitation \Pal`pi*ta"tion\, n. [L. palpitatio: cf. F. palpitation.] A rapid pulsation; a throbbing; esp., an abnormal, rapid beating of the heart as when excited by violent exertion, strong emotion, or by disease. |
